MANILA - Miss Earth 2013 Alyz Henrich of Venezuela arrived Friday in the Philippines, heralding the start of the environment protection-oriented international pageant in the country.

Along with Miss Philippines-Earth Jamie Herrell, Henrich is set to welcome some 90 candidates who will compete for the crown.

Henrich's arrival gave new impetus to the world beauty pageantry which has been beset by uncertainty and cancellations this year.

 

On Thursday, Binibining Pilipinas-Intercontinental Kris Janson's departure for Jordan was cancelled after the organizers of the Miss Intercontinental pageant announced that they had to reschedule the contest due to security concerns in the region.

The Miss Universe organization, meantime, has yet to officially address reports that it is not holding any competition this year. US media earlier announced that the Miss Universe pageant will be held in January 2015 in Florida.

The Miss Earth pageant is regarded as one of the top pageants in the world, along with Miss Universe, Miss World, and Miss International.

The Miss Earth coronation night will be held at the UP Theater in Quezon City on November 29. It will be aired on ABS-CBN, TFC and Star channels.
